    AVANIR Gets $40M In PIPE


    Aliso Viejo-based AVANIR Pharmaceuticals said this morning that it has raised $40M in a registered direct offering from its venture investors. The funding was led by ProQuest Investments, and also included Clarus Ventures, Vivo Ventures, and OrbiMed Advisors. Piper Jaffray & Co. was the sole placement agent on the offering. AVANIR, which is developing biopharmaceuticals for the treatment of chronic disease, said the funding would go to Phase II STAR trials of its Zenvia compound. Zenvia is targeted at treating diabetic peripheral neuropathic pain.
